Brown Sugar Pork Chops

Juicy, thick-cut pork chops with a caramelized brown sugar glaze, seared then oven-baked for a sweet and savory main dish.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Chill Time 5 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 2 servings
Calories 490 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 2 large bone-in pork chops, thick-cut (roughly 1.5 inches / 3.8 cm thick)
  • 1/2 cup packed dark brown sugar 100 g
  • 2 tbsp unsalted butter, melted 28 g
  • 1 tbsp ap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p smoked paprika
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p kosher salt
  • 1/2 tsp freshly cracked black pepper
  • 1 tbsp finely chopped fresh parsley for garnish

Instructions
 

  • Season Pork Chops:

    Using paper towels, thoroughly dry the pork chops. Coat each side evenly with kosher salt, black pepper, smoked paprika, and garlic powder, working the seasonings into the meat.
  • Sear in Skillet:

    In a cast-iron skillet set over medium-high heat, warm the olive oil until it shimmers. Place the pork chops in the skillet and sear for exactly 2 minutes per side, until a deep golden-brown crust develops.
  • Make Glaze Mixture:

    Combine the melted butter, dark brown sugar, and apple cider vinegar in a small bowl, whisking until smooth. Drizzle this mixture over the seared pork chops.
  • Bake Pork Chops:

    Place the skillet into a preheated 400°F (205°C) oven. Bake for 10–12 minutes, or until the internal temperature reads 140°F (60°C) and the glaze is bubbling.
  • Broil to Caramelize:

    Turn the oven to high broil. Broil the chops for 1–2 minutes, until the sugar caramelizes deeply and edges become slightly charred. Keep a close eye to avoid burning.
  • Rest and Serve:

    Take the skillet out of the oven and move the chops to a plate. Allow them to rest for 5 minutes, during which the internal temperature will climb to 145°F (65°C). Sprinkle with fresh parsley and serve alongside mashed potatoes.
